On Thursday 01 July 2004 18:10, Edulix wrote:
> Hello one more time,
>
> As others seem to already asked without reply, I'm getting lower speed
> rates than specified via ingress. How do I know. Because I have this in my
> script:
>
> tc qdisc add dev $DEV handle ffff: ingress
>
> # Filter intranet traffic, so fit it to intranet speed
> tc filter add dev $DEV parent ffff: protocol ip prio 10 u32 \
> match ip src $Q_2_HOSTS \
> match ip dst $Q_2_HOSTS \
> police rate ${LAN_SPEED}mbit burst 10k drop flowid :2
>
> So let's say I execute a X -query to the my pc. Everything goes fine and
> fluently till I activate my script ingress rules!Then kde seems sluggish.
> and LAN_SPEED is "100" (mbit) !
>
> I don't think the problem is that I have many ingress filters because even
> if I deactivate them (i.e. comment on them in my script) kde slows down
> after adding the tc filter mentioned above.
>
> Please, have you got any idea what might be going on ? Any comments,
> suggestions? Have you had the same experience ? What do you think the
> problem might be ? Am I asking in the wrong forum ? Should report this bug
> to tc developers ? Come on and reply me ;-).
Can you post the tc counters?
tc -s -d qdisc filter ffff:
